Artürs Motmillers
HERO OF WORLD WAR II

Name: | Artürs Motmillers | ||
Born: | 1.10.1900 | ||
Nationality: | Latvia | ||
Club affiliation: | ASK Riga | ||
Personal record: | 2:41:38 |
He took part in the Kosice marathon 7 times between 1930 and 1937 (every year except 1931).During
the Second World War he joined the resistance movement. He died in a concentration camp.
Košice (MMM): | 1930 | 4th place | 2:57:37,8 | |
1932 | 4th place | 2:47:30 | ||
1933 | 2nd place | 2:41:38,2 | ||
1934 | 8th place | 2:53:52 | ||
1935 | winner | 2:44:57 | ||
1936 | 10th place | 2:56:48 | ||
1937 | 15th place | 3:06:59 | ||
